Looking sharp. What did you do to shine up the aluminum rail and fitting? Also would you mind telling me where you got your jump seats?

Thanks lokonn, the bow rails are origional in good shape, I built the jump seats, I used 5/8th plywood sewed the light and dark grey vinyl added padding then stapled to the ply, cut out aluminum as you can see I used diamond plate aluminum for the bottom, screwed the seat to it, did the same with the back but covered it with carpet, the boxes are built with 3/4 plywood covered with carpet, I bought the seat hinges, I hope this helps
